For electric power transmission, copper or aluminium wire is used.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

(i.) Copper and aluminium contain large number of free electrons.
(ii.) These free electrons can move throughout conductor easily.
(iii.) This results into copper and aluminium having low values of resistivity.
(iv.) Thus, copper and aluminium are good conductors of electricity and offer low resistance to the flow of current.
Hence, aluminium and copper are used for electric power transmission.
